A client has an office with 40 real estate agents sharing twenty 9600 series IP telephones. A 20-channel SIP trunk on a dedicated 2 MR connection will be used. The LAN has a 5 MB VLAN with QoS to support the VoIP traffic. The customer wants the highest voice quality while keeping Voice Compression Modulo (VCM) resource use at a minimum. Which codecs should be used for the SIP trunk and IP telephones to meet the client requirements?

Options

  • AG.711 for the SIP trunk and G.711 for the IP telephones
  • BG.711 for the SIP trunk and G.729(a) for the IP telephones
  • CG.729(a) for the SIP trunk and G.711 for the IP telephones
  • DG.729(a) for the SIP trunk and G.729(a) for the IP telephones
